Naples Winter Wine Festival Honored as “Best Wine Festival” (2025) in the United States in Latest USA Today 10 Best Readers’ Choice Award
The Naples Children & Education Foundation (NCEF), the founding organization of the Naples Winter Wine Festival (NWWF), is proud to announce that USA Today readers across the country have voted the NWWF as the country’s “Best Wine Festival” for 2025, recognizing the Festival with USA Today’s 10Best Readers’ Choice Award.
With three days of activities, the NWWF showcases dozens of award-winning chefs and renowned vintners who generously donate their time and talents at intimate wine dinners across Naples, plus an incredible live auction with one-of-a-kind auction lots. The 2025 NWWF raised a record of over $34 million toward NCEF’s mission of transforming the lives of children in need.
“We are just really thrilled and honored to be recognized as the best wine festival in the United States for 2025, which coincided with our 25th anniversary celebration,” said Naples Children & Education Foundation CEO Maria Jimenez-Lara. “We are also deeply grateful to our incredible volunteers, partners, vintners, chefs, supporters and guests who made this recognition possible.”
Since its inaugural event in 2001, the NWWF has raised more than $336 million, making a profound and sustaining difference in the lives of the most vulnerable children in Collier County.

About Naples Winter Wine Festival
The Naples Winter Wine Festival (NWWF), one of the world’s most prestigious charity wine auctions, offers a weekend of unforgettable memories. Guests enjoy world-class food and wine during intimate dinners in elegant, private homes and other landmark settings throughout Naples and are invited to bid on once-in-a-lifetime travel and wine experiences during an electrifying live auction. Since its inaugural event in 2001, the NWWF has raised more than $336 million, making a profound difference in the lives of hundreds of thousands of children in Collier County.
About Naples Children & Education Foundation
The Naples Children & Education Foundation (NCEF), the founding organization of the Naples Winter Wine Festival, is improving the educational, emotional and health outcomes of underprivileged and at-risk children. Through its annual grants and strategic initiatives, NCEF has impacted close to 90 of the most effective nonprofits in the local community, providing 385,000 children with the services and resources they need to excel. NCEF’s unique approach, which emphasizes collaboration between organizations and bridges public and private resources, has become a blueprint for how to transform a community, one issue at a time.
